Output 355f3ec30625b40be6b203d2183bb6821aaae0ea1e5954002e42eb357b44d629:1

value
1403450577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a78688753402646e1e2a5f2a0fdc2f1888a70c4 OP_EQUAL
address
MAK83XwBqyPqBTB2Q2qsqNt58efkS9m93R
transaction
355f3ec30625b40be6b203d2183bb6821aaae0ea1e5954002e42eb357b44d629
spent
true